For this month's "People" section, we have invited Linda Liepa – Social Media Manager, who creates content on CoinGate company page on LinkedIn. She is here to share her insights and provide some tips from her experience!
How do you research and plan your content topics?
I stay current on what is happening in the industry through news and social listening to determine industry trends when researching content topics. Additionally, I check what international celebrations/awareness days could be incorporated into our LinkedIn posts every month for fun content.
While planning content, I keep in mind the content strategy to make sure to do different formats of posts such as images, PDFs, videos, articles, and polls. And content should be diverse to educate and entertain.
How do you ensure that your content aligns with the company's brand and messaging?
I follow our brand guidelines to ensure the content on LinkedIn aligns with our brand messaging, tone of voice, and visual identity. Before posting on LinkedIn, you must identify a content strategy for a platform to achieve your LinkedIn company page goals.

What are the main practical tips for LinkedIn business page content?
Do's:
✅ Repurpose blog content into videos, articles, carousels, and image posts. The same applies to re-using your best-performing posts.
✅ Provide testimonials in the form of case studies and customer reviews.
✅ Make your posts visually attractive to stop the "scroll" – format paragraphs and choose engaging visuals.
✅ Analyze impressions and engagement to understand what content your audience engages with the most and adjust your content strategy accordingly.
Don'ts:
❌ Don't do promotional posts about your business without adding value for your audience. Focus on the problems your product/service solves and share the story through testimonials, case studies, and showcasing people behind your brand.
❌ Don't use complicated words in the copy – make sure the language of the posts is simple and understandable for the current and potential audience.
❌ Don't use too many hashtags – remember to keep them relevant to the content you want your page to be associated with.
